Fact-Checking and Verification
Prediction market content is time-sensitive content. Getting platform fees, regulatory status, or geographic availability wrong can cost readers money.
Platform Intelligence Documents
We maintain verified internal docs for every platform — fees, features, regulatory status, geographic availability, withdrawal methods, KYC requirements. Every published claim is verified against these before publication.
First-Hand Testing
We test platforms with our own money. Real deposits, real trades, real withdrawals. Where we haven't tested a specific aspect, we say so rather than speculating.
Source Standards
We prioritize primary sources: platform websites, CFTC filings, regulatory announcements, and our own testing data. We cite specific data with timeframes, not vague comparative claims.
Verification Before Publication
If a factual claim cannot be verified against a primary source or our own testing data, it is removed or clearly marked as unconfirmed.

Correction Policy
When we get something wrong, we fix it and say so. We do not silently edit published content.
How Corrections Work
Factual errors corrected within 48 hours. Affected pages display a correction note — what changed, what the original error was, and when. Material corrections to platform reviews are noted in the review's change log.
Reporting Errors
Email info@insidepredictions.com with the page URL and specific error. We investigate every report and respond with the outcome.
Proactive Updates
We don't wait for readers to find errors. Platform reviews re-verified monthly. Fee, regulatory, and geographic changes trigger updates within 48 hours.
Transparency
Every review displays a 'Last Updated' date reflecting the most recent verification. Silent edits are prohibited — if we change something, we document it.
Editorial Independence
Inside Predictions earns revenue through affiliate partnerships with prediction market platforms. Here is how we keep affiliate revenue separate from editorial decisions.
Rankings and scores are determined by our published evaluation methodology, not by commission rates. Every platform review includes a substantive limitations section documenting genuine drawbacks. We review platforms that have no affiliate relationship with us. If a platform terminates its affiliate relationship, we continue to cover it with the same editorial standards.
